Using and Customizing Event Trigger Applets

Triggers

You can add three different riggers to your event trigger applet:

  • MQTT Trigger: this triggers the applet whenever a message is sent to the selected topic
  • Webhook Trigger: this triggers the applet whenever the named webhook is activated
  • AI Trigger: this has three subdivisions:
  • Dialogflow Trigger: this triggers the applet whenever the named Dialogflow Intent is triggered
  • Object Detection: this triggers the applet whenever the selected object is detected using MakerCloud's AI Object Detection
  • Face Detection: this triggers the applet whenever a face is detected using MakerCloud's AI Face Detection

Logic

You can add MQTT-based if/then logic to your applet.

  • Using Condition 1, you can check the contents of a general MQTT message on a topic using a variety of comparators.
  • Using Condition 2, you can check the contents of a message on a topic and data type using a variety of comparators. You can check the contents of key-value messages or simple messages sent to the selected data type.

  • By Selecting "Add to same level", you can add it to the base level of logic.
  • By selecting "Add to sub level", you can create a sub level of logic to increase the detail of your applet. When you add a second statement or sub level, click "AND" to switch between an and statement and an or statement.

Action/Response

You can add two different actions and one response to your event trigger applet:

  • IFTTT Action: this activates the named IFTTT webhook with the specified values in the optional message.
  • MQTT Action: this publishes a simple of key-value message to the selected topic.
  • HTTP Response: this sends a simple or key-value http message.
